Output 63ef8136d6946b8bee4cdb41ee535cf58d17ce1c8f29cb2c0c76ea771a9e5a07:0

value
105795011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4f53bc385572025ce61d0a10b17734488983ae0 OP_EQUALVERIFY OP_CHECKSIG
address
1JxRDidTZqYQrv7WjH1zjcdj29kFNzfy3j
transaction
63ef8136d6946b8bee4cdb41ee535cf58d17ce1c8f29cb2c0c76ea771a9e5a07
spent
true